Question 67391This question is from textbook
: 2/5x +1 = 1-x
On both sides of the equal sign are absolute value brackets. What I'm unsure of is, what or how do I get rid of the fraction 2/5x ?

|(2/5)x +1| = |1-x|
Find the zero values.
(2/5)x+1=0
x=-5/2
----------
1-x=0
x=1
------------
Draw a number line and mark two points as -5/2 and 1.
This breaks the number line into three segments. We
need to look for solutions in each segment, keeping in
mind the definition of absolute value.
------------------------------------
In the segment (-inf,-5/2) you get:
-(2/5x+1)=1-x
(2/5)x+1=x-1
(3/5)x=2
x=10/3
-------------
In the segment (-5/2,1) you get:
(2/5)x+1=1-x
(7/5)x=0
x=0
-------------
In the segment (1,inf) you get:
(2/5)x+1 = x-1
-(3/5)x=-2
(3/5)x=2
x=10/3
-------------
Check these answers:
If x=0, |(2/5)x+1| = 1 = |1-x|
If x=10/3, |(2/5)x+1] = |4/3+3/3| = 7/3 = |10/3-1|
